Intermittent headlight problem

The passenger side low beam bulb appears to be dead- but I will just turn the headlights off and back on and it will sometimes come back on. The bulb color looks normal, I am reading that they usually go pink before dying, I will check the fuses first, but anyone else have this problem?

Before you throw any money at it, it'd be best to swap the igniters (from driver's side to passenger) then the ballasts to determine which is bad. I don't see igniters going bad as often as the ballasts but YMMV.

I would try swapping over the bulbs first as this will only take you minutes to do.

If that doesn't work then as thoiboi mentioned you can begin swapping over the igniter / inverter but this will be more labor involved such as removing bumper and headlight assembly.
